Proceed with caution

Why
Strong standards backing and exploding coverage, but live data shows demand is mostly artificial and an independent academic audit plus a real exploit (402Bridge) show the spec omits security-critical details. Promising rail, not yet a dependable one.
Next
Run a sandboxed shadow integration on Base testnet behind the BIL deploy-safe gate; require idempotency-key binding and replay protection per the arXiv findings before any mainnet path; do NOT trust client-sent amounts (Rule #1/#3).
